Data Science Online Course 2024 takes center stage, offering a comprehensive journey into the world of data. This course empowers you to unlock the secrets hidden within data, equipping you with the knowledge and skills to analyze, interpret, and utilize data effectively.
With the rapid advancement of technology, an Information Technology Degree in 2024 can be a valuable asset. This program will equip you with the skills to design, develop, and manage information systems, making you a valuable asset in today’s digital world.
From the fundamental concepts of data collection and cleaning to the intricacies of machine learning algorithms, this course covers a wide range of topics that are essential for success in the field of data science. You’ll delve into the diverse applications of data science across industries, learn to leverage powerful tools and technologies, and gain practical experience through engaging case studies.
Interested in the justice system and criminal behavior? A Criminology Degree in 2024 can equip you with the knowledge and skills to analyze crime, understand its causes, and contribute to the development of effective solutions.
Contents List
- 1 Introduction to Data Science
- 2 Understanding Data Types and Structures: Data Science Online Course 2024
- 3 Data Exploration and Visualization
- 4 Statistical Concepts for Data Science
- 5 Machine Learning Algorithms
- 6 Data Preprocessing and Feature Engineering
- 7 Model Evaluation and Selection
- 8 Data Science Tools and Technologies
- 9 Final Conclusion
- 10 FAQ Summary
Introduction to Data Science
Data science is a rapidly growing field that involves extracting knowledge and insights from data. It encompasses various techniques and methodologies to collect, clean, analyze, and interpret data to solve real-world problems and make informed decisions.
Fundamental Concepts
Data science involves a systematic approach to understanding data, from its initial collection to its final interpretation. The key concepts include:
- Data Collection:Gathering raw data from various sources, such as databases, APIs, sensors, and social media platforms.
- Data Cleaning:Preprocessing data to handle missing values, outliers, and inconsistencies to ensure data quality and accuracy.
- Data Analysis:Applying statistical methods and machine learning algorithms to explore patterns, trends, and relationships within the data.
- Data Interpretation:Drawing meaningful conclusions from the analysis, communicating findings effectively, and providing actionable insights to stakeholders.
Applications of Data Science
Data science has revolutionized numerous industries by enabling data-driven decision-making. Some prominent applications include:
- Healthcare:Predicting disease outbreaks, personalizing treatment plans, and developing new drugs and therapies.
- Finance:Detecting fraudulent transactions, optimizing investment strategies, and assessing credit risk.
- E-commerce:Recommending products, personalizing customer experiences, and optimizing pricing strategies.
- Marketing:Targeting customers effectively, analyzing campaign performance, and understanding customer behavior.
Key Skills and Tools
A successful data scientist requires a diverse skillset and proficiency in various tools and technologies:
- Programming Languages:Python and R are widely used for data manipulation, analysis, and visualization.
- Statistical Concepts:Understanding probability distributions, hypothesis testing, and statistical inference is essential for data analysis.
- Machine Learning Algorithms:Proficiency in various algorithms, including linear regression, logistic regression, decision trees, and clustering algorithms, is crucial for building predictive models.
- Data Visualization Tools:Tools like Tableau, Power BI, and Matplotlib enable effective communication of insights through data visualizations.
- Domain Expertise:Understanding the specific industry or domain in which data science is being applied enhances the ability to derive relevant insights.
Understanding Data Types and Structures: Data Science Online Course 2024
Data comes in various forms, and understanding these types and how they are structured is crucial for effective data analysis.
Data Types
Data types describe the nature and characteristics of data. Common data types in data science include:
- Numerical Data:Quantitative data that can be measured numerically, such as age, height, or income. It can be further categorized into:
- Continuous Data:Data that can take on any value within a range, like temperature or height.
- Discrete Data:Data that can only take on specific values, like the number of children in a family or the number of cars in a parking lot.
- Categorical Data:Qualitative data that represents categories or groups, such as gender, marital status, or color. It can be further categorized into:
- Nominal Data:Data that has no inherent order or ranking, like colors or types of fruits.
- Ordinal Data:Data that has a natural order or ranking, like educational levels or customer satisfaction ratings.
- Textual Data:Unstructured data in the form of text, such as reviews, articles, or social media posts.
Data Structures
Data structures provide a way to organize and manipulate data efficiently. Common data structures used in data science include:
- Arrays:One-dimensional collections of elements of the same data type, typically used to store lists of numbers or strings.
- Matrices:Two-dimensional arrays, often used to represent tables or images, where elements are arranged in rows and columns.
- Data Frames:Tabular data structures that combine different data types, often used to represent datasets with multiple variables and observations.
Real-World Datasets
Various real-world datasets can be represented using different data structures. For example:
- A dataset of customer demographics can be represented using a data frame, with columns for age, gender, income, and location.
- A dataset of stock prices over time can be represented using an array, with each element representing the price at a specific point in time.
- A dataset of images can be represented using matrices, where each element represents the pixel value at a specific location in the image.
Data Exploration and Visualization
Data exploration and visualization play a crucial role in understanding data and extracting meaningful insights.
Looking to make a positive impact in the public sector? An MPA Degree in 2024 can provide you with the skills and knowledge to lead and manage effectively in government and non-profit organizations.
Exploratory Data Analysis (EDA)
EDA involves examining data to identify patterns, trends, and outliers. It helps to:
- Understand Data Characteristics:Explore the distribution of variables, identify potential relationships between variables, and assess data quality.
- Identify Patterns and Trends:Discover hidden patterns, trends, and anomalies that might not be immediately apparent from raw data.
- Formulate Hypotheses:Develop hypotheses about the data based on the insights gained during EDA.
Data Visualization Techniques
Data visualization techniques use graphical representations to communicate insights from data effectively. Common techniques include:
- Histograms:Show the distribution of a single variable, displaying the frequency of different values.
- Scatter Plots:Show the relationship between two variables, revealing potential correlations or trends.
- Box Plots:Summarize the distribution of a variable, highlighting its median, quartiles, and outliers.
- Line Charts:Show the trend of a variable over time, revealing patterns and changes over time.
- Heatmaps:Represent correlations between multiple variables, revealing relationships and dependencies.
Examples of Visualization Tools
Visualization tools can be used to gain a deeper understanding of data and identify key relationships. For example:
- Tableau:A powerful tool for creating interactive dashboards and visualizations from various data sources.
- Power BI:A business intelligence tool that allows users to connect to data sources, create visualizations, and share insights.
- Matplotlib:A Python library for creating static, animated, and interactive visualizations in Python.
Statistical Concepts for Data Science
Statistical concepts provide a foundation for analyzing data and drawing meaningful conclusions.
Fundamental Statistical Concepts
Key statistical concepts relevant to data science include:
- Probability Distributions:Models that describe the likelihood of different outcomes in a random event, helping to understand the variability of data.
- Hypothesis Testing:A framework for testing claims about populations based on sample data, enabling data-driven decision-making.
- Statistical Inference:Using sample data to make generalizations about the population from which the sample was drawn, allowing for drawing conclusions about the broader population.
- Regression Analysis:Techniques for modeling the relationship between variables, enabling prediction and understanding of causal relationships.
Applications of Statistical Concepts
Statistical concepts are applied in various data science tasks, such as:
- Predicting Customer Churn:Using regression analysis to model the factors that influence customer churn and predict which customers are likely to leave.
- Evaluating the Effectiveness of Marketing Campaigns:Using hypothesis testing to determine whether a marketing campaign has a significant impact on sales.
- Analyzing the Performance of Machine Learning Models:Using statistical measures like accuracy, precision, and recall to evaluate the performance of predictive models.
Machine Learning Algorithms
Machine learning algorithms are at the heart of many data science applications, enabling computers to learn from data and make predictions or decisions.
Core Concepts of Machine Learning
Machine learning can be broadly categorized into three types:
- Supervised Learning:Algorithms that learn from labeled data, where the input data is paired with the desired output. Examples include linear regression, logistic regression, and decision trees.
- Unsupervised Learning:Algorithms that learn from unlabeled data, discovering patterns and relationships within the data. Examples include clustering algorithms and dimensionality reduction techniques.
- Reinforcement Learning:Algorithms that learn by interacting with an environment, receiving rewards for desired actions and penalties for undesired actions. Examples include game-playing algorithms and robotics applications.
Machine Learning Algorithms
Various machine learning algorithms are used for different tasks, each with its strengths and weaknesses:
- Linear Regression:Used for predicting continuous values based on a linear relationship between variables.
- Logistic Regression:Used for predicting binary outcomes (e.g., yes/no, true/false) based on a logistic function.
- Decision Trees:Tree-like structures that represent decision rules, enabling classification and prediction.
- Clustering Algorithms:Used to group data points into clusters based on similarity, enabling segmentation and anomaly detection.
- Support Vector Machines (SVMs):Used for classification and regression, finding the optimal hyperplane that separates data points into different classes.
- Neural Networks:Complex interconnected networks of nodes that mimic the human brain, capable of learning complex patterns and making predictions.
Strengths and Weaknesses of Algorithms
The choice of algorithm depends on the specific task, the nature of the data, and the desired outcome. It’s important to consider the strengths and weaknesses of different algorithms before selecting one for a particular application.
Looking to expand your knowledge or learn new skills? Online University Courses in 2024 offer a flexible and accessible way to learn from renowned universities around the world.
Data Preprocessing and Feature Engineering
Data preprocessing and feature engineering are essential steps in preparing data for machine learning models.
Data is king, and with a Data Analyst Degree in 2024 , you can unlock its potential. This program will equip you with the skills to analyze data, identify trends, and make informed decisions for businesses and organizations.
Data Preprocessing
Data preprocessing techniques aim to clean, transform, and scale data to improve the performance of machine learning models. Common techniques include:
- Data Cleaning:Handling missing values, outliers, and inconsistencies to ensure data quality and accuracy.
- Data Transformation:Converting data into a suitable format for analysis, such as standardizing units or applying logarithmic transformations.
- Feature Scaling:Scaling features to a common range, such as normalization or standardization, to prevent features with larger ranges from dominating the learning process.
Feature Engineering, Data Science Online Course 2024
Feature engineering involves creating new features from existing data that can improve the performance of machine learning models. It involves:
- Combining Existing Features:Creating new features by combining existing features, such as calculating the ratio of two variables or creating interaction terms.
- Extracting Features from Text:Using natural language processing (NLP) techniques to extract features from text data, such as sentiment scores or topic s.
- Generating Features from Images:Using computer vision techniques to extract features from images, such as object detection or image segmentation.
Examples of Preprocessing and Feature Engineering
Here are examples of how preprocessing and feature engineering can be applied to real-world datasets:
- In a customer churn prediction model, feature engineering might involve creating new features based on customer demographics, purchase history, and engagement metrics.
- In an image classification model, preprocessing might involve resizing images to a uniform size and applying data augmentation techniques to increase the dataset size.
Model Evaluation and Selection
Model evaluation and selection are crucial steps in ensuring that the chosen machine learning model performs well on the given task.
Want to delve into the complexities of the human mind? A Bachelor’s Degree in Psychology in 2024 can open doors to various career paths, from counseling and research to human resources and marketing.
Model Evaluation Metrics
Various metrics are used to evaluate the performance of machine learning models, providing insights into their accuracy, precision, recall, and overall effectiveness. Common metrics include:
- Accuracy:The proportion of correctly classified instances.
- Precision:The proportion of true positive predictions among all positive predictions.
- Recall:The proportion of true positive predictions among all actual positive instances.
- F1-score:A harmonic mean of precision and recall, providing a balanced measure of model performance.
- ROC AUC:A measure of the model’s ability to distinguish between positive and negative classes, often used for binary classification tasks.
Cross-Validation and Hyperparameter Tuning
To ensure that a model generalizes well to unseen data, cross-validation techniques are used to split the data into training and testing sets. Hyperparameter tuning involves adjusting the model’s parameters to optimize its performance on the training data.
Model Selection
After evaluating different models using various metrics, the model with the best performance on the validation set is typically selected for deployment. It’s important to consider the trade-offs between different metrics and choose the model that best aligns with the specific task and business objectives.
In an increasingly digital world, cybersecurity is paramount. Cyber Security Schools in 2024 are offering specialized programs to train professionals who can protect organizations from cyber threats and ensure data security.
Examples of Model Evaluation and Selection
In a spam detection model, evaluating the model’s precision and recall would be crucial to ensure that it accurately identifies spam emails while minimizing false positives. In a fraud detection model, optimizing the model’s F1-score would be important to balance the need for high precision (avoiding false positives) with high recall (avoiding false negatives).
Data Science Tools and Technologies
Data science workflows involve a range of tools and technologies that enable data manipulation, analysis, visualization, and model deployment.
Want to shape young minds and inspire future generations? A Bachelor of Education in 2024 can prepare you for a fulfilling career in education, where you can make a lasting impact on the lives of students.
Programming Languages
Python and R are widely used programming languages in data science, offering a rich ecosystem of libraries for data manipulation, analysis, and visualization.
- Python:Popular for its versatility, extensive libraries (e.g., NumPy, Pandas, Scikit-learn), and ease of use.
- R:Strong for statistical analysis, data visualization (e.g., ggplot2), and specialized packages for specific domains.
Cloud Computing Platforms
Cloud computing platforms provide scalable and cost-effective solutions for data storage, processing, and model deployment.
Want to pursue a degree without leaving the comfort of your home? Consider an Online Bachelor’s Degree in 2024. This flexible option allows you to learn at your own pace and balance your studies with other commitments.
- AWS (Amazon Web Services):Offers a wide range of data science services, including Amazon S3 for storage, Amazon EMR for big data processing, and Amazon SageMaker for machine learning.
- Azure (Microsoft Azure):Provides data science services like Azure Blob Storage for data storage, Azure Databricks for big data analytics, and Azure Machine Learning for model development and deployment.
- Google Cloud Platform (GCP):Offers services like Google Cloud Storage for data storage, Google BigQuery for data warehousing, and Google AI Platform for machine learning.
Other Relevant Tools and Technologies
Other tools and technologies commonly used in data science workflows include:
- Jupyter Notebook:An interactive environment for data exploration, analysis, and visualization, allowing for code execution, visualization, and documentation within a single notebook.
- Tableau:A powerful data visualization tool for creating interactive dashboards and visualizations from various data sources.
- Power BI:A business intelligence tool for connecting to data sources, creating visualizations, and sharing insights.
- Git:A version control system for tracking changes in code and data, enabling collaboration and reproducibility.
Final Conclusion
Embrace the power of data science in Data Science Online Course 2024. This course is your gateway to a world of possibilities, equipping you with the skills and knowledge to navigate the data-driven landscape and make a real impact.
Aspiring to lead in the business world? Consider enrolling in MBA courses in 2024. These programs offer a comprehensive understanding of business principles, strategy, and leadership, preparing you for senior management roles.
Whether you aspire to become a data scientist, data analyst, or machine learning engineer, this comprehensive program provides the foundation for a successful career in this dynamic field.
For those looking to specialize in a specific area of nursing, Nursing Courses in 2024 offer a wide range of options. From pediatrics to oncology, you can find a course that aligns with your interests and career goals.
FAQ Summary
What are the prerequisites for this course?
Want to make a difference in the lives of others? Enrolling in Nursing Classes in 2024 can be a rewarding experience. You’ll learn the skills and knowledge necessary to provide compassionate care to patients in various settings.
Basic programming skills and a fundamental understanding of mathematics and statistics are recommended, but not strictly required. The course is designed to cater to individuals with varying levels of experience.
A Bachelor of Arts in 2024 can be a versatile degree, offering a wide range of specializations from humanities and social sciences to communication and design. This degree equips you with critical thinking, communication, and research skills.
What is the duration of the course?
The course duration is typically [insert course duration], and can be completed at your own pace.
Is there a certification available upon completion?
If you’re passionate about protecting lives and property, a Fire Science Degree in 2024 might be the perfect path for you. This program equips you with the knowledge and skills to prevent fires, manage emergencies, and ensure the safety of your community.
Yes, upon successful completion of the course, you will receive a [insert certificate details] certificate.
What are the job opportunities after completing this course?
Looking to upgrade your skills in the digital world? There are a variety of IT programs in 2024 that can help you land your dream job in the tech industry. From software development to cybersecurity, there’s a program for everyone.
Graduates of this course are well-equipped to pursue roles such as Data Scientist, Data Analyst, Machine Learning Engineer, and Data Engineer, among others.